Digital tools and professional teacher practise

This is the first post in my professional practise blog. In this post I want to detail a few reasons and thoughts about the blog itself.

As a Beginning Teacher (BT) in New Zealand, my pre-service teacher education has taught me to be reflective of my practise in order to improve on it and become a better teacher. This can be done easily enough on a computer by using any text editing software on the market. This is a perfectly valid way of documenting one's reflections, especially if the intended audience is one's self or one's Tutor Teacher.
